CAR SEAT STATS: YOUR ROLE AS THE PARENT DEFINED
Given the probability of infant death while riding in a car unrestrained, it is vital to know your role as the parent on this important issue. Small kids and babies are not able to strap themselves in when in a car, so rely on their parents or caregivers to take this safety precaution for them. But in order to maximize the safety benefits of car seats, you have to use the right one and make sure it is installed properly. Misuse of a car seat, improper installation, or using a seat that is intended for a different size and weight of child can all put your baby’s life in jeopardy. And, experts recommend keeping babies facing backwards as long as possible and at least as long as the height and weight restrictions of their seat. When those limits are met, it is time to move on to the next biggest car seat and use it until it is also outgrown.
